London Blue Topaz and the Appeal of Asscher Cut Faceting

London blue topaz is known for its rich, deep blue tone that carries subtle cool undertones. This gemstone color offers a refined alternative to more traditional engagement stones while still maintaining an elegant and sophisticated appearance.

The Asscher cut is valued for its distinctive step-cut faceting and symmetrical structure. Rather than emphasizing sparkle alone, this cut highlights clarity and geometric precision, creating a reflective, hall-of-mirrors effect that enhances the gemstone’s depth and character.

What makes the Asscher cut unique for an engagement ring?
The Asscher cut is known for its square shape and step-cut facets that create a distinctive geometric appearance. This structure emphasizes clarity and symmetry, producing a reflective visual effect rather than traditional sparkle.
What is a double halo setting in an engagement ring?
A double halo setting surrounds the center gemstone with two layers of smaller accent stones. This design increases visual brilliance and creates a larger overall appearance for the center stone while adding depth to the ring design.
Is London blue topaz a good choice for an engagement ring?
London blue topaz is appreciated for its deep blue color and refined appearance. When set securely and worn with appropriate care, it can be enjoyed regularly as a distinctive alternative to more traditional engagement gemstones.
What design style is associated with Art Deco rings?
Art Deco jewelry is known for its bold geometry, symmetry, and architectural design. Rings inspired by this style often feature structured shapes, strong lines, and balanced gemstone settings.
